Hi Level up. Thanks for the kind words and welcome home. I miss Chris too bro! Man though, your in great hands living near Joe Filisko and all his guys as Im sure you know. Some of the young harp guys on my radar anyway that are really sounding great and are also kinda new to the scene or audiences anyway are: 1. Konstantin Kolesnichenko 2.) Konstantin Reinfeld 2.) Jarred Goldwebber 3.) Omar Coleman 4.) Hank Shreve 5.) Ilya Portnov Im sure Im forgetting a couple but all of these guys are wonderous players and have all re-inspired me over and over.
